STAMFORD, Conn. Nov. 7, 2012 /3BL Media/ – Keep America Beautiful (KAB), the nation’s largest nonprofit that builds and sustains vibrant communities, will award Xerox Corporation with its 2012 Vision for America Award in New York City.

Xerox is being honored for the corporation’s significant leadership role in social and environmental stewardship, philanthropy, and enlightened corporate citizenship. The Vision for America Award is presented annually to distinguished leaders of honored corporations whose personal and corporate commitment have significantly enhanced civic, environmental and social stewardship throughout the United States.

Keep America Beautiful cited several specific corporate efforts which led to the recognition:

  • As the world’s leader in managed print services, Xerox has reduced energy use and waste associated with printing for companies and government agencies by up to 30 percent.
  • The Xerox Green World Alliance reuse/recycle program for imaging supplies is central to its commitment to waste-free products. Worldwide, Xerox customers returned more than 3.43 million cartridges, toner containers and other used supply items in 2011.
  • Xerox has retained its position on the FTSE4Good rating scheme by meeting the criteria for environmental actions, corporate responsibility, social and stakeholder engagement and human rights for the fifth consecutive year.
  • Nearly 1,700 nonprofit organizations, colleges and universities received direct financial support from the Xerox Foundation through grants, matching gifts or community involvement activities in 2011.
  • Nearly 12,300 Xerox employees volunteered in more than 750 projects through Xerox’s Community Improvement Program.

About Keep America Beautiful, Inc.
Keep America Beautiful is the nation’s leading nonprofit that brings people together to build and sustain vibrant communities. With a network of more than 1,200 affiliate and participating organizations including state recycling organizations, we work with millions of volunteers to take action in their communities through programs that deliver sustainable impact. Keep America Beautiful offers solutions that create clean, beautiful public places, reduce waste and increase recycling, generate positive impact on local economies and inspire generations of environmental stewards. About Xerox Corporation
With sales approaching $23 billion, Xerox (NYSE: XRX) is the world’s leading enterprise for business process and document management. Its technology, expertise and services enable workplaces – from small businesses to large global enterprises – to simplify the way work gets done so they operate more effectively and focus more on what matters most: their real business. Headquartered in Norwalk, Conn., Xerox offers business process outsourcing and IT outsourcing services, including data processing, healthcare solutions, HR benefits management, finance support, transportation solutions, and customer relationship management services for commercial and government organizations worldwide. The company also provides extensive leading-edge document technology, services, software and genuine Xerox supplies for graphic communication and office printing environments of any size.
